Hatboro-Horsham senior midfielder Julie McKay has made a verbal commitment to play Division I lacrosse at American University.
Julie McKay log:

High School: Hatboro-Horsham
Graduation Year: 2012
Position: Midfield
College Choice: American University
Club Affiliation: Phantastix
Major lacrosse honors: PASLA School Girls National Tournament team (for the past two years), 1st team All-League for Midfield, 3rd team All-Continental
Academic honors: Academic All-American, National Honors Society, Distinguished Honor Roll
What will you major in/study? “I am not totally sure what I want to major in, but I think something with International Business or Political Science.”
Why did you choose school? “I chose American University because I fell in love with the school and DC every time I visited. The girls and the coaches are so nice and welcoming to new people, which was comforting. I also think that American will set me up to do great things in life, and being in DC will provide many opportunities.”
